首页 > 编程语言 >无涯教程-JavaScript - LOGEST函数

无涯教程-JavaScript - LOGEST函数

时间:2023-09-22 20:04:20浏览次数:32  
标签:返回 const JavaScript 无涯 LOGEST 如果 数组 known

描述

在回归分析中,计算适合您数据的指数曲线,并返回描述该曲线的值数组。由于此函数返回值数组,因此必须将其作为数组公式输入。

语法

LOGEST (known_y's, [known_x's], [const], [stats])

争论

Argument 描述 Required/Optional
Known_y's

在关系y = b * m ^ x中,您已经知道的y值集合。

如果数组known_y位于单个列中,则known_x的每一列都被解释为一个单独的变量。

如果数组known_y位于单个行中,则将known_x的每一行解释为一个单独的变量。

Required
Known_x's

您可能已经在关系y = b * m ^ x中知道了一组可选的x值。

数组known_x可以包含一组或多组变量。如果仅使用一个变量,则已知_y和已知_x可以是任何形状的范围,只要它们具有相等的尺寸即可。如果使用多个变量,则known_y必须是高度为一行或宽度为一列(也称为向量)的单元格范围。

如果省略了known_x,则假定其为数组{1,2,3,...},其大小与known_y相同。

Optional
Const

一个逻辑值,指定是否强制常数b等于1。

如果const为TRUE或省略,则b将正常计算。

如果const为FALSE,则将b设置为1,并将m值拟合为y = m ^ x。

Optional
Stats

一个逻辑值,指定是否返回其他回归统计信息。

如果stats为TRUE,则LOGEST返回其他回归统计信息,因此返回的数组为{mn,mn1,...,m1,b; sen,sen-1,...,se1,seb; r 2,sey; F,df; ssreg,ssresid}。

如果stats为FALSE或省略,则LOGEST仅返回m系数和常数b。有关其他回归统计信息的更多信息,请参考LINEST函数。

Optional

Notes

  • 曲线的等式是-

    y = b * m ^ x

    y =(b *(m1 ^ x1)*(m2 ^ x2)* _)

    如果存在多个x值,则从属y值是独立x值的函数。 m值是对应于每个指数xvalue的基数,b是常数值。请注意,y,x和m可以是向量。

  • LOGEST返回的数组为{mn,mn-1,...,m1,b}。

  • 您的数据曲线越像一条指数曲线,所计算的线越适合您的数据。 LINEST和LOGEST都返回一个描述值之间关系的值数组,但是LINEST拟合数据的直线,而LOGEST拟合指数曲线。

  • 如果只有一个独立的x变量,则可以使用以下公式直接获得y截距(b)的值-

    Y轴截距(b):INDEX(LOGEST(已知_y,已知_x),2)

  • 您可以使用y = b * m ^ x方程来预测y的将来值,但是GROWTH函数的作用相同。

  • 在输入数组常量(如known_x)作为参数时,请使用逗号分隔同一行中的值,并使用分号分隔行。分隔符可能会有所不同,具体取决于您的区域设置。

  • 您应该注意,如果回归方程预测的y值超出了您用来确定方程的y值范围,则可能无效。

  • 如果known_x的数组长度与known_y的数组长度不同,则LOGEST返回#REF!错误值。

  • 如果提供的known_x或known_y数组中的任何值都不是数字(这可能包括数字的文本表示,因为LOGEST函数无法将它们识别为数字),则LOGEST返回#VALUE!错误值。

  • 如果无法将const或stats参数中的任何一个判断为TRUE或FALSE,则LOGEST返回#VALUE!错误值。

适用性

Excel 2007,Excel 2010,Excel 2013,Excel 2016

Example

Logest Function

参考链接

https://www.learnfk.com/javascript/advanced-excel-statistical-logest-function.html

标签:返回,const,JavaScript,无涯,LOGEST,如果,数组,known
From: https://blog.51cto.com/u_14033984/7570474

相关文章

  • 基于事件的 JavaScript 编程:构建交互式 Web 应用程序
    了解事件 1.事件类型JavaScript支持多种事件类型。一些最常见的包括:鼠标事件:这些事件由用户与鼠标的交互触发,例如单击、悬停和拖动。键盘事件:这些事件在用户与键盘交互时发生,例如按下某个键或松开某个键。表单事件:与表单元素相关的事件,例如提交表单或更改输入字段的值。......
  • 企业微信机器人Javascript调用例子
    constkey=""constoWX_URL='https://qyapi.weixin.qq.com/cgi-bin/webhook/send?key='+key;constsent_msg={'msgtype':'text','text':{......
  • 无涯教程-JavaScript - GAMMA.DIST函数
    描述GAMMA.DIST函数返回伽马分布。您可以使用此功能来研究可能具有偏斜分布的变量。伽马分布通常用于排队分析。语法GAMMA.DIST(x,alpha,beta,cumulative)争论Argument描述Required/OptionalXThevalueatwhichyouwanttoevaluatethedistribution.RequiredAlp......
  • javascript数据类型
    原视频:https://www.bilibili.com/video/BV15T411j7pJ?p=9&vd_source=9752cdd43d8570cd76479220c765bc34一、数据类型分类number:数字类型,整型,浮点型,二进制,十六进制(如0x99=十进制的9*16+9=153),八进制,NaNstring:字符串boolean:布尔型truefalseundefined:未定义类型null:空对象unde......
  • javascript: The Best Guided Tour Plugin
    BestTourPluginsToGuideVisitorsThroughYourApphttps://yonkov.github.io/post/display-shepherd-only-once/https://www.jqueryscript.net/blog/best-guided-tour.htmlhttps://whatfix.com/blog/react-onboarding-tour/https://github.com/shipshapecode/shepherdhtt......
  • Odoo 通过Javascript调用模型中自定义方法
    实践环境Odoo14.0-20221212(CommunityEdition)代码实现在js脚本函数中调用模型中自定义方法:this._rpc({model:'demo.wizard',//模型名称,即模型类定义中_name的值method:'action_select_records_via_checkbox',//模型中自定义名称args:['arg_value......
  • odoo中用javascript调用model中定义好的方法,及要注意的坑
    odoo中如果前端界面要调用后台model中写好的方法,很简单。使用do_action即可,比如要调用改res.users的默认语言后执行的方法odoo.define('switch_language.SwitchLanguageMenu',function(require){"usestrict";varModel=require('web.Model');varsessi......
  • 无涯教程-JavaScript - F.INV函数
    描述F.INV函数返回F概率分布的倒数。如果p=F.DIST(x...),则F.INV(p...)=x。F分布可用于比较两个数据集变异程度的F检验。语法F.INV(probability,deg_freedom1,deg_freedom2)争论Argument描述Required/OptionalProbabilityAprobabilityassociatedwiththeF......
  • 无涯教程-JavaScript - FISHER函数
    描述FISHER函数返回x处的Fisher变换。这种转换产生的功能通常呈正态分布而不是倾斜。使用此功能对相关系数执行假设检验。语法FISHER(x)争论Argument描述Required/OptionalXAnumericvalueforwhichyouwantthetransformation.RequiredNotesFisher变换的等......
  • JavaScript Library – Svelte
    前言上一回我介绍了 Alpine.js。作为我开发企业网站draft版本的renderengine。用了一阵子后,我觉得它真的非常不好用。所以打算换一个。前端有好几个framework/library/compiler都可以用来做MVVMrenderengine。比如Angular、React、Vue、LIt、Solid、Qwik、Svelt......